What to expect
Rafting down the Martha Brae River you'll be transported into a tropical paradise filled with mango trees, mangroves and palms. On this half day excursion, you'll be guided downriver in a bamboo raft to soak up this exotic landscape, just a short journey away from Montego Bay.Floating downstream in a one or two-seater raft, your guide will navigate these green waters to take you on a journey through lush forest. You'll spot tropical plants and birds singing in the treetops as well as mangroves and palms swaying in the wind.What's more, you'll learn the stories and legends surrounding this historic route, including local myths about a secret cave. Perfect for nature lovers and those wanting complete peace and tranquillity.
